Subject: Handover — Poolworks releases

You own Poolworks releases starting next sprint. Note for plugin authors: the pooler now caps connections per plugin at 8; anything holding more gets evicted. Ship the advisory with 2.3. Rotated credentials last night, old ones dead Monday. Sign plugin bundles with the following key.

signing key of bagap-yawep = bky13_TbfT6ZMUoGJo2

## Runbook: Lintbarrow Baseline Refresh

The baseline file suppresses pre-existing findings so new code stays clean. Regenerate it only after a sweep ticket is approved; never hand-edit entries. If the analyzer reports a baseline checksum mismatch, re-run the refresh job from a clean checkout. The refresh job reads the settings shown below.

settings of bafof-fajog:
[aldix]
port = 9300
region = north-3
host = aldix.kelvilabs.example
team = istath
timeout_ms = 1500
retries = 8

Subject: Handover — Merrow DNS flakiness

Handing off the intermittent resolution failures in the Merrow deploy pipeline. Symptom: roughly one in forty resolutions to the artifact mirror times out, retries succeed. Suspected stale negative caching on the Oakhollow resolvers; a patch is up for review that adds retry jitter and a fallback resolver. To push the hotfix through the pipeline you'll need the deploy key, which is as follows.

release key, hadug-kawef: bky13_mPGeFZeR1GZ1G

Action item from the Mirewater tide-table widget incident. Owner: release manager. Widget cached stale harbor offsets after the DST change, showing tides six hours off for two days. Required: add a cache-invalidation check to the release checklist, block deploys when offset tables are older than 24 hours, and verify the Saltgate harbor feed before each cut. Deadline: next release. Checklist template and sign-off procedure are documented on the internal page below.

wiki page, kawif-bajep: https://artifactory.zarqelforge.internal/issue/browse/display/display/projects/spaces/secrets/000fe6ec5a46af29355003e1